HDB Approved Brady, Jack and Lizzie are looking for homes to call their own!
The siblings are 6 months old and healthy. They are vaccinated, microchipped and sterilised. They are currently pee pad and grass trained but are slowly learning to go fully in grass. They are learning on leash and will need some time and patience to get better. They are still teething and cannot be left alone for prolonged periods as they would need potty time(4 to 6 hours at most alone). They are petite in size as their mama is equally petite. We expect them to be medium Singapore Specials. Brady is the more confident and bolder boy. He is the first to explore and tends to lead his siblings along. Jack is the more reserved and quieter boy. Jack would do very well in a household with cats or other animals as he tends to sit back and watch without being overly enthusiastic in his approach. Lizzie is affectionate and mild in nature. She enjoys playing with toys.

What does sponsorship cover?
Sponsorship helps cover food, including special diets, healthcare such as vet visits, worming, flea and tick treatment, heartworm preventative and also goes towards any adoption costs, transportation and rehabilitation training if needed. |
Rescue, Restore, Re-Home
Our main aim once we rescue an animal is to help it find it's forever home. They enter into our health and rehabilitation program. They learn basic commands, walking as well as learning to socialise and play. We also work on common behavioural issues. |

Points to Note
Sponsorship allows an animal to be sponsored by more than one person. A sponsor may identify with a particular dog or cat after visiting the shelter or our web site and they may already be sponsored. Rather than restrict love, we believe having more people that care, gives the animals a better chance at having a new life. We treat all animals in our care equally whether sponsored or not. Your gift is used to help all the dogs and cats including the one you have chosen to sponsor.
